Web20 Jan 2024 · Serological markers for HBV infection consist of HBsAg, anti-HBs, HBeAg, anti-HBe, and anti-HBc IgM and IgG. The identification of serological markers allows: to identify patients with HBV infection to elucidate the natural course of chronic hepatitis B to assess the clinical phases of infection and to monitor antiviral therapy .

Recommendations for Routine Testing and Vaccination for Chronic Hepatitis B virus Infection redbud tree wildlife valueWebThe specimen of choice for the diagnosis of HBV infection is blood. Serological tests for viral antigens and antibodies are typically used for diagnostic screening and can be performed on either serum or plasma.
